Suppose that you want to construct a voltaic cell from nickel and cadmium for a chemistry project. You take all the precautions necessary to deal with a toxic heavy metal like cadmium, and you decide to use a 0.01 M solution of cadmium nitrate as one of the electrolytes. If you need a cell potential of 0.17 V for this system, what concentration of NiCl2 should you use?
